A Technical Operator in food manufacturing ensures production lines run safely, efficiently, and consistently. The role blends machine operation, quality control, and problem-solving to keep food products flowing smoothly through the factory.
Key Responsibilities
- Operate production machinery to meet daily output targets
- Set up, adjust, and change over machinery as required
